Around one-quarter to one-third of … WebActivated clay (kaolin) has been used in protecting grains from the attack of storage insects. This method is very effective against most of the storage pests and nontoxic to higher animals. The kaolinate clay after successive processes of activation with acid and heat can be used as physical poison. Grain … WebAbout 30 species of insect commonly infest food aid grain and grain products. Most insect pests are either beetles or moths. In addition to insects, the only other invertebrates that are commonly found in stored food are mites.
